1. Prepare your business for sale
Before putting your business on the market, it’s important to make sure that it’s in top shape. This includes ensuring that your financial records are up to date and accurate, your operations are running smoothly, and your business is well-positioned in the market. Consider hiring a business broker or valuation expert to assess the value of your business and identify areas where you can improve to increase its value.
2. Determine the value of your business
One of the key steps in selling your business is determining its value. This will help you set a realistic asking price and attract potential buyers. Factors that can influence the value of your business include your revenue and profits, assets, market position, customer base, and growth potential. Work with a professional business appraiser to get an accurate valuation of your business.
3. Find the right buyer
Once you’ve determined the value of your business, it’s time to start looking for potential buyers. Consider reaching out to your network of contacts, hiring a business broker, or listing your business on online marketplaces and business-for-sale websites. Make sure to screen potential buyers to ensure that they are qualified and capable of running your business successfully.
4. Negotiate the terms of the sale
When you’ve found a potential buyer, it’s important to negotiate the terms of the sale. This includes discussing the purchase price, payment terms, transition period, and any other terms or conditions related to the sale. Make sure to consult with legal and financial advisors to ensure that the terms of the sale are fair and beneficial to both parties.
5. Finalize the sale
Once you’ve agreed on the terms of the sale, it’s time to finalize the transaction. This includes drafting a sales agreement, conducting due diligence, transferring ownership of assets, and completing any necessary legal and financial paperwork. Make sure to work with professionals, such as lawyers and accountants, to ensure that the sale is completed smoothly and legally.
6. Transition out of your business
After selling your business, it’s important to plan for a smooth transition out of the business. This may include training the new owner, introducing them to key customers and suppliers, and ensuring that your employees are informed about the change in ownership. Consider staying on as a consultant or advisor to help facilitate the transition and ensure the long-term success of your business.
